UEFA Youth League alum Jurrien Timber watches Nwaneri score Arsenal's first UYL goal in 7 years
Published: September 20, 2023
Recuperating Arsenal defender Jurrien Timber was in attendance at Meadow Park in Hertfordshire as Arsenal began their UEFA Youth League campaign with a 2-1 loss to PSV Eindhoven on Wednesday afternoon.
Timber is an alumnus of the UEFA Youth League as he played seven matches in the competition in the 2018-2019 season before breaking into the first team of Ajax Amsterdam.
Two players of Nigerian descent were on parade at Meadow Park, with Ethan Nwaneri making his full debut for the Gunners in the UEFA Youth League and Lagos-born centre-back Emmanuel van de Blaak going the distance for the Dutch team.
Nwaneri gave the home side the lead in the 31st minute when he made the most of the ball in the 18-yard box before finding the bottom right corner.
Emir Bars restored parity for the Dutch side in the 41st minute through a deflected before Jason van Duiven got the winner in the 69th minute.
Nwaneri's strike against PSV was Arsenal's first goal in the UEFA Youth League since December 6, 2016 when Eddie Nketiah netted in a 1-1 draw at Basel.
It has been an impressive start to the campaign for the Anglo-Nigerian midfielder who has become a vital player for Arsenal's development side.
The 16-year-old has started all Premier League 2 games for Mehmet Ali's side and has notched 4 goals and one assist.
